Now, Thailand isn’t only a paradise having backpackers and you may honeymooners, however, a button appeal nation to have migrant experts, people trafficking and pressed work. When you look at the 2019, a projected 3.nine billion migrant gurus was in fact traditions and working within the Thailand, one another legally and you can illegally. Many came from neighbouring Cambodia, Lao People’s Democratic Republic, Myan. 480,000 was projected is stateless, while 100,one hundred thousand was basically refugees and you will asylum seekers.
For more than two and a half decades, the labour migration to help you Thailand has went on to increase plus it appears unlikely that it’ll change in the coming many years. All of the known victims over the past year showed up of Myanmar, however, usually Thai nationals are also pushed, coerced, otherwise fooled into the work or sexual exploitation. Victims is actually trafficked to own intimate exploitation domestically also to a number off regions all over the world. Though migrants out-of neighbouring regions constitute the great majority regarding recognized trafficked people for the Thailand, it’s very obvious there exists many others that have yet becoming identified. In order to get into Thailand lawfully, migrants have to go owing to an “MoU process”, a contract amongst the governing bodies away from Cambodia, Laos and you can Myanmar one to kits a channel having court labor migration from these regions. This step, yet not, shall be costly, a lot of time and state-of-the-art – meaning that of a lot migrant workers are gonna keep using unlawful channels to operate into the Thailand. The difficulties aren’t solely due to the Thai government regardless if, eg, it can be costly to have Myanmar residents to apply for passports within nation and also for of many ethnic minorities it is almost hopeless.
In the a report released very early 2019, this new Un Worldwide Organization out of Migration revealed the situation during the Thailand while the less than.
The new mainly useless and you will actually ever-altering rules enjoys left migrants from inside the good precarious legal status and you will avoided them out of completely contributing because the members of Thai community. Perform to market safe and regular migration will in all probability confirm unsuccessful until guidelines are created and accompanied to make certain migrant workers’ legal rights and you may dignity are fully protected.
To protect those that is most prone to trafficking and you will intimate exploitation, the fresh Thai bodies has actually enacted progressive principles one make certain migrants access to several essential functions no matter courtroom reputation, in addition to training and you may health care. Yet not, barriers continue steadily to hinder their access to these services in practice. Only 51 % of all of the qualified migrants are presently subscribed to personal medical health insurance techniques, whenever you are doing 200,100000 migrant children are still out of school. The possible lack of access to these societal protection nets, words traps and lower monetary and social status sign up to the latest vulnerability of children to several forms of trafficking, especially sexual exploitation.
To end exploitation up against migrant professionals and their group also to be certain that the secure migration into Thailand, ECPAT Sweden and the faith-dependent creativity organization Diakonia, become your panels Secure Migration. In addition to lover organisations, Diakonia inside Thailand was in it project into facts related so you can people liberties, regional democracy, public and you may economic justice and sex equivalence. The essential focus of the functions includes the newest legal rights away from stateless someone and you may cultural minorities. Agricultural employees are specifically affected by such injustices. A lot of them don’t have the most elementary defenses and minimum-wage, overtime spend, others day, annual leave, sick exit and you can social safety.
Extremely migrant experts don’t discover minimum wage. Based on Thai work legislation, the minimum wage is decided so you can 310 baht each and every day, an amount most companies don’t shell out even if it’s punishable because of the doing half a year in prison and you will a 100,100000 baht great.
